    Choosing the Right Toner Bottle: Pump, Spray, or Flip-Top Cap?
    May 28, 2025
    Introduction Selecting the right toner bottle is key to user experience and product appeal. Pump, spray, and flip-top cap designs each offer unique benefits. This guide helps you decide which suits your product best by exploring their features, uses, and ideal scenarios.   1. Pump Bottles: Precision for Controlled Application   Pump bottles use a mechanical dispenser to release measured amounts of toner. Each press delivers a consistent dose, reducing waste and contamination by minimizing air contact. They’re perfect for thick or concentrated formulas, letting users apply product precisely with fingertips or a cotton pad. Brands can customize pump components—like nozzle size or pressure—to match product viscosity. While ideal for targeted use, they require two hands and may be less convenient for on-the-go users compared to other designs.     2. Spray Bottles: Effortless Even Application   Spray bottles, supported by spray bottle manufacturer expertise, atomize toners into fine mists for easy, mess-free coverage. Lightweight and portable, they’re popular for mist-formulated toners, appealing to busy, travel-oriented audiences. The mist reduces hand contact, lowering bacteria risk, and offers quick, refreshing use. Manufacturers offer nozzle options—fine mist or continuous spray—to suit product delivery needs. However, thicker toners may clog spray nozzles over time, making this design best for lightweight liquids.   3. Flip-Top Caps: Simple and Cost-Effective   Flip-top caps provide a straightforward, budget-friendly solution. Hinging open to reveal an opening for pouring or shaking, they work with various toner consistencies, from liquids to slightly thick formulas. Their simplicity makes them reliable and easy to use, ideal for home applications. These caps are less prone to mechanical issues and offer easy filling (or refilling if reusable). But they lack dose control, risking spills or overuse without a narrow nozzle—balance convenience with your product’s application needs. Choosing the Right Design Consider these factors: Product Texture: Pumps for thick toners; sprays/flip-tops for lighter liquids. User Needs: Precision (pump), portability (spray), or simplicity (flip-top). Branding Goals: Pumps suggest premium quality, sprays convenience, flip-tops practicality. Manufacturing Partnerships: Work with a spray bottle manufacturer or packaging expert to customize materials and design for your brand.   Conclusion   Pump, spray, and flip-top toner bottles each have distinct advantages. Pumps ensure precision, sprays offer ease (especially with a reliable manufacturer), and flip-tops balance cost and simplicity.
